What Are Emulsifiers?
Emulsifiers are important ingredients that assist blend 2 substances that normally do not combine, like oil and water - Emulsifiers. You'll find them in various items, both food and cosmetics, making certain a smooth structure and steady formulation. When you enjoy a creamy salad dressing or use a moisturizer, emulsifiers play an essential function in keeping those items uniform and pleasurable to use
In food, emulsifiers can enhance tastes, improve life span, and create attractive textures. In cosmetics, they aid mix oils with water-based ingredients, permitting effective application and absorption. Common emulsifiers consist of lecithin, mono- and diglycerides, and polysorbates, each offering certain features to maintain stability. Emulsifiers Defined and Functions
On the planet of food and cosmetics, emulsifiers play an essential duty in blending compounds that usually don't mix, like oil and water. These substances function by decreasing the surface tension between both stages, allowing them to combine smoothly. You can consider emulsifiers as the bridge that connects these active ingredients, guaranteeing security and consistency in your items. They aid produce luscious textures in sauces, dressings, and creams, enhancing your total experience. By promoting harmony, emulsifiers additionally boost the rack life of products, stopping splitting up in time. Kinds Of Emulsifiers
While you may not recognize it, there are different kinds of emulsifiers that offer distinct purposes in food and cosmetics. You'll experience natural emulsifiers, like lecithin from eggs and soy, which are frequently utilized in dressings and spreads. After that, there are artificial emulsifiers, such as polysorbates, generally found in creams and creams for their security and effectiveness. An additional classification is semi-synthetic emulsifiers like mono- and diglycerides, which help improve structure in baked items. Each type has unique properties, affecting exactly how items really feel and behave. Emulsification Process Discussed

To achieve emulsification, you typically need to integrate the components while applying power, like shaking or mixing. This action aids break down the oil into smaller sized beads, making it easier for the emulsifier to do its task. Applications of Emulsifiers in Food Products
Worldwide of foodstuff, emulsifiers play an essential role in creating attractive structures and improving security. You'll discover them in every little thing from salad dressings to gelato, where they aid blend oil and water, stopping separation. When you delight in a creamy mayo, it's the emulsifiers that guarantee that smooth uniformity you like.
They also improve the life span of items by maintaining harmony, which can be vital for customer complete satisfaction. In baked products, emulsifiers help trap air, leading to a light and fluffy texture. If you value the moistness of a cake or the inflammation of bread, emulsifiers are vital gamers in achieving those top qualities.

Emulsifiers in Aesthetic Formulations
While you may not understand it, emulsifiers are necessary in cosmetic formulations, making certain that items like lotions and lotions preserve their desired structure and stability. These materials assist blend oil and water, protecting against separation and creating a smooth, consistent consistency - Emulsifiers. When you use a cream, for example, emulsifiers allow the formula to move effortlessly onto your skin, boosting absorption
Different kinds of emulsifiers serve numerous functions. Some supply a lightweight feeling, while others create a richer, extra glamorous texture. They likewise play a role in enhancing the service life of your favored products by maintaining them against adjustments in temperature and humidity.
